KNMC seeks Hi-line musicians for Havre Festival days rock lotto event

 

July 31, 2019

Rock Lotto 2018 during the Havre Festival Days.

MSU-Northern's campus radio station, KNMC 90.1FM, is seeking hi-line area musicians and vocalists of all skill levels to sign up for the 4th annual Rock Lotto, Saturday, September 21st during Havre Festival Days.

KNMC Rock Lotto is an event where local musicians put their name in a drawing to be randomly placed into bands for a one-time only performance. Musicians may sign up to play an instrument (guitar, bass, drums, keys, horns) or as a lead/backup vocalist. If a participant can play more than one instrument, they are encouraged to list their backup instrument in case too many signed up to play a particular instrument.

The deadline to signup is Wednesday, August 14th at noon. The band drawing will be held that evening during Sounds on the Square. Once the bands have been assembled, a subsequent drawing will be held to assign songs for each band to learn. Bands will have 5 weeks to rehearse for their performance. Last year, 35 Havre area musicians signed up to create 7 bands, which performed on the town square during the Festival Days celebration.

Before Havre had an annual Festival Days celebration, a music festival was held every May from the 1930s through the 1960s which brought regional bands to town to perform. KNMC seeks to honor that tradition by inviting musicians around the hi-line to join the fun by creating bands to perform at the Rock Lotto.
